Polls from the Past 580 Days [View all]

I just wonder how Romney expects to win if

-He has only lead in the polls for 12 of the past 580 days

-He hasn't lead in the polls once in the past 11 months

-His highest level of support was 46.8%, which lasted for one day

-His typical level of support hovers around 43%

-His largest lead over Obama was 0.6 points, which was 12 months ago and only lasted for one day


Doesn't it seem like, if you look at the evidence, this election isn't really that close? Obama has lead 98% of the time over the past 19 months. Is this really going to come down to the wire?
